Day Tour to Sakkara & Memphis


Duration: 4 hour(s) - Location: Your hotel

On this tour we will travel to Memphis (Mit Rahina), the capital of Ancient Egypt and learn about its Pharaonic history. We will view the enormous and unfinished statue of Ramses II and then continue to on to Saqqara, which served as the main necropolis of Memphis, and visit the Step Pyramid of King Zoser. Our final stop is a carpet school to learn how handmade carpets are manufactured. There is an opportunity to visit the Papyrus Institute or Perfume Palace if you prefer.
